Step 1. The most time consuming part of this lei is the prep work. Before assembly, cut all the ribbon to length. For this lei, I cut the curling ribbon into 12″ length pieces. I used 74 green pieces, 73 blue pieces, and 72 silver pieces. Step 2. Next, put together the money flowers using the green curling ribbon.Do the same accordion fold to this bill. Put the two bills together, matching them in the center and tie with a small ribbon. Cut the ribbon to leave small antennas for the butterfly. Tie the butterfly around the string of the lei. With the dollar bill folds pushed together (accordion closed), hold the bill in place, and carefully tie a nice, tight double knot around the dollar bill in the desired spot on the money lei necklace.When you have everything you need to make your money lei, it's time to get crafting! The first step is to take each $1 bill (or higher if you're a big spender!) and fold it in half. Then fold it in half again. Then fold it in half a third time. When you have folded it a third time, unravel it.Once all bills and papers are folded, create the "wheels" that will make up the lei. Take a folded dollar and, folding along the initial crease, bring the ends together and fasten with double-sided tape. Then fan out the other side of the dollar and tape the ends together too, forming a wheel. Create as many wheels as you plan to use.Tie each piece in the middle and then fanned each bill out to look more like a “flower.”. Thank you!!In this video, I will be sho...I’m thinking when we are in ‘shelter in place’ or ‘ work from home’, and want to make our own son/daughter/love one a lei for graduation, birthday or special...The very first banknotes were used by the Chinese in the 7th century, during the Tang Dynasty. Before it was used as an actual currency, paper money was part of a deposit system in which merchants would leave large amounts of coins with a trusted associate and receive a paper receipt for the transaction. Thread a piece of ribbon through the middle of the “flower” and ...Pick 60 hardy pua melia (plumerias). Soak in tub of water for 5 to 10 minutes. Drain and let sit. Spread nūpepa (newspaper), then pepa (paper) towel on it. Place your flowers on it. Measure embroidery thread (can use dental floss as a substitute) to desired length of lei and add another 6″ for tying. For best results, use double string.
